Should I trade my car in?

I bought a 2011 honda civic and it's a nice car just got it in march and I really want to trade it in at the same dealer I went to and get something else like a camaro will they refinance me? Is it worth it?

If you have good credit and some cash money they will love for you to come in and do a trade.

You paid retail price for the Civic. They will give you a whole trade in price. Probably a couple of thousand less than you paid. Then you pay full retail for the Camero, plus Tax, Title, and Registration Fees all over again. You would end up paying around $3000 more even if both cars have about the same retail value.

Worth it or not depends on how much you hate the Civic and love the Camero. Depends on how much money you have burning a whole in your pocket.

They willprobably refinance you, if your credit is good. Is it worth it? That depends how much you still owe on the Honda. These numbers are just an example:: but say you bought the Honda for $14,000 in March. This is middle of May., so you have made maybe 2 payments? So you probably owe $13,000 or more. They may give you a trade in value of $8000,00 for the Honda. Now the Camero is $15,000. When you finance it, they will add what you still owe on the Honda, which now is $5000.00 So now the camero is going to cost you $20,000. I would say No its not worth it. Depending what you actually paid and what you still owe, The camero may cost you way more than its worth.

The Honda Civic is a very good car and have a very good reputation. It sounds like you have already made up your mind to just trade it in. Keep in mind however that you will get less for it as a trade in than you would if you were to sell it out right. They have to resell it at a profit, so they would give you much less than you would get if you sold it out right. Look at the Blue book value online and it will show you exactly what I'm trying to explain here. However IF you do not want the hassle of selling it and the haggling with people it may be worth the loss to you to just trade it in.
